FASCITIS PLANTAR: EPI VS ONDAS DE CHOQUE. REVISIÓN BIBLIOGRÁFICA

Abstract

La fascitis o fasciosis plantar es una de las principales talalgias en la población adulta, representando el 80% del dolor de talón. La etiología de ésta patología es muy difusa y tiene un amplio abanico de técnicas de tratamiento, factores que incitan a estudiar sobre qué técnica es la más acertada. El objetivo del trabajo es determinar y comparar la eficacia que tiene el tratamiento de la fascitis o fasciosis plantar a través de Electrólisis Percutánea Intratisular (EPI) y ondas de choque. Se ha realizado una revisión bibliográfica en Medline, Scopus y ScienceDirect, obteniendo publicaciones desde el 15 de Abril hasta el 15 de Mayo, en las que obtengamos conclusiones sobre ambos tratamientos para poder contrastarlos, ya que no hay ningún estudio experimental que lo haga. Se ha optado por elegir 7 artículos (3 de EPI y 4 de ondas de choque), de los que se ha extraído información sobre el tipo de estudio, la población diana, periodo de tiempo y resultados. A través del análisis de los estudios se observa que ambos tratamientos son eficaces a la hora de abordar la patología, mejorando todos los objetivos propuestos al inicio del estudio. Bien es cierto que se precisa de estudios de mayor calidad que comparen ambas técnicas para poder analizar resultados más relevantes.
